Ernulf de Hesden, lord of Hesdin near Montreuil, whose ancestry is unknown (or not traced here), married Emmeline (…), whose ancestry is also unknown (or not traced here).1
Ernulf de Hesden, lord of Hesdin near Montreuil was tenant-in-chief in several English counties in 1086. He was a benefactor of the priory of St. George at Hesdin.2
